osrocket said:here is a litte input since i am being referred to, if it was overpinched the first thing i would have done is email osrocket and he could relieve it the same as ray!!!!!
the pull start RG engines are one of the harder to set for the pinch because there is very little pinch to begin with and all the guys that i do like them extra tight so they last longer, yes you may have to replace the 12.00 rod, but if it is in need of a pinch the rod is questionable anyway,
also the squeezer ring is garbage as anyone will tell you it makes them out of round, you may as well trash them after that,
i started this 6 years ago approx. 2 1/2 years before ray came up with the arbor press and slug deal, and i did many for him before that, and i do it on a cnc controlled machine which is highly accurate, but most important is my service is perfect and all guys will tell you that from experience, And when we attend the big races (200 plus entries) matt(my son) usually always makes the A main in 1/8 buggy expert and also 1/8 unlimited truggy, running O.S. engines that have been pinched and polished , not modified. First off, I apologize for anything I stirred up.
I figured it was normal as it was my first pinch job. I don't doubt your ability or your work. I can vouch that the pinch is tight. I've just never had to deal with that tight of an engine before. It was a tough learning experience. All the info I found was basically to use a starter box... the reason I got it re-pinched was due to saving money. Buying a starter box just wasn't worth it.
I think it's going to work out ok. I ran it this weekend in my buggy and it has a lot of snap now. I've run about 1/2 gallon through it since I started this thread. It still gets stuck at the top and I have to rotate the flywheel with channel locks, but as long as I start on the downstroke, it pulls over and starts just fine.
Next time I'll ask before I beat myself to death trying to "make" it work. I just figured for $20, you wouldn't really want to be bothered with it. I mean, you pinched it, tighter than it was when it was new. What more could I ask?
